For link speeds of 8.0 GT/s and above, the transmitter presets and the receiver preset hints are configurable parameters which can be tuned to establish a stable link. This allows setting up a stable link that is specific to the peers across a Link. The device-tree property 'eq-presets-Ngts' (eq-presets-8gts, eq-presets-16gts, ...) specifies the transmitter presets and receiver preset hints to be applied to every lane of the link for every supported link speed that is greater than or equal to 8.0 GT/s. Hence, enable support for applying the 'optional' lane equalization presets when operating in the Root-Port (Root-Complex / Host) mode.
